Conventional Cataract Surgery Pros and Cons
When taking into consideration traditional cataract surgical procedure, you may discover that it's a reputable and widely-used method. In this treatment, a specialist makes a little cut in the eye and utilizes ultrasound to break up the gloomy lens before removing it. When the cataract is gotten rid of, a man-made lens is put to recover clear vision.
One of the major advantages of standard cataract surgery is its record of success. Several individuals have actually had their vision substantially boosted through this procedure. Furthermore, traditional surgery is commonly covered by insurance, making it an extra easily accessible choice for many people.
However, there are some drawbacks to typical cataract surgical treatment as well. Recuperation time can be much longer compared to newer strategies, and there's a slightly greater threat of difficulties such as infection or inflammation. Some patients might also experience astigmatism or require analysis glasses post-surgery.
Laser-Assisted Techniques Advantages And Disadvantages
Checking out laser-assisted techniques for cataract surgery introduces a modern-day technique that utilizes laser innovation to perform crucial steps in the treatment. One of the key benefits of laser-assisted cataract surgical procedure is its accuracy. The laser allows for incredibly accurate cuts, which can lead to much better aesthetic results. In addition, using lasers can decrease the amount of ultrasound power required during the surgery, possibly lowering the danger of issues such as corneal damage.
On the downside, laser-assisted methods can be more pricey compared to standard approaches. This price mightn't be covered by insurance policy, making it less accessible to some individuals.
One more factor to consider is that not all cataract cosmetic surgeons are learnt laser modern technology, which could restrict your options for choosing a doctor.

Comparative Analysis of Both Techniques
For a detailed understanding of cataract surgical procedure strategies, it's essential to conduct a relative analysis of both traditional and laser-assisted techniques.
Typical cataract surgery entails hand-operated lacerations and making use of portable devices to separate and eliminate the gloomy lens.
On the other hand, laser-assisted cataract surgical treatment makes use of advanced innovation to create exact lacerations and separate the cataract with laser power before removing it.
In regards to accuracy, laser-assisted techniques supply a greater level of precision contrasted to standard methods.
